Not cheap but Worth Every Penny

Being a proud Grandfather of a one year old boy I am always looking for ways to show the kid off. When I was given an opportunity to test www.pictureitpostage.com I could not resist. PictureItPostage™ is real US Postage created by Endicia™ (en-dee-shya), the leading distributor of Internet (PC) postage by volume in the United States. You just go to the www.pictureitpostage.com, read the instructions, and follow them. Of course you will need a photo and some way to charge the cost online. All photo stamps are checked so they do not contain photos that are outside the U.S. Postal Service guidelines. I assume you get what I mean.

You can download their software if you wish. I decide to use their online tools to create my stamps. That took about 8 minutes the first time. Just choose a photo from your files and upload it. Then edit it within the stamp area. Stamps can be horizontal or vertical. I choose horizontal. Then decide on the amount or value of the stamps. I choose the standard one ounce letter at 42 cents. There are many options. You also need to designate the number of stamps you want. Stamps come in sheets of 10. No orders less than 20 stamps or 2 sheets. See mine here. The sample has been altered so the bar code is useless.

webPictureitpostage

The cost of 20 one ounce first class stamps with shipping is around $23.00. That is a little over a buck each. That is right. This is not your Post Office. You are buying the rights to use a custom photo on a postage stamp to impress your friends, show your family you love them, or just because you can. This is also used by businesses to impress customers or prospects.
